Bills need talent transfusion for switch in scheme

"It's a lot more about the "who" than the "how" when it comes to the Buffalo Bills' switch to a 4-3 defense this season. Who they can add to the defense will be far more important in determining their success than how they line up.

One key addition to the defense already is in house. The Bills hope Shawne Merriman can recover from an Achilles tendon injury that has ruined three of his last four seasons. Merriman can put his hand on the ground and rush off the edge as part of a four-man line in passing situations. He has the size and stoutness to hold the edge against the run as a strong-side linebacker.

The Bills need a good complement -- or two -- for Merriman, since his ability to stay healthy for a full season is a question mark.

The 4-3 defense gives the Bills flexibility in looking for solutions. An undersized, 245-pound defensive end can serve as a situational pass rusher. Whether it's an undersized, 245-pound defensive end, a 260-pounder who spent most of his time at linebacker in college or a 285-pounder, it doesn't really matter. The Bills' challenge this offseason is to find a good one (or two) and utilize him in whatever way works best -- standing up or with his hand on the ground; on the line or at linebacker.

"It's tougher to find people for the true 3-4 in a lot of ways," Bills coach Chan Gailey said. "So it makes it a little bit easier to find some people from time to time to run a four-man front than it does a three-man front. It just gets extremely hard to find those outside 'backers year in and year out. It gets tougher and tougher.""
